Market Stats

Global medical engineered materials market size and share is currently valued at USD 17.05 billion in 2022 and is anticipated to generate an estimated revenue of USD 62.50 billion by 2032, according to the latest study by Polaris Market Research. Besides, the report notes that the market exhibits a robust 13.9% Compound Annual Growth Rate (CAGR) over the forecasted timeframe, 2023 – 2032

Medical Engineered Materials Market Advantages 

  • Biocompatibility – Ensures safe use in medical devices, implants, and drug delivery systems.
  • Sterilization Resistance – Withstands high temperatures and chemicals without degrading.
  • Enhanced Performance – Improves strength, flexibility, and durability in medical applications.
  • Lightweight Solutions – Reduces patient discomfort in prosthetics and wearable devices.
  • Customization – Allows for patient-specific implants and surgical tools.

Regional Analysis

The medical engineered materials market is expanding globally, with North America dominating due to a well-established healthcare infrastructure, high R&D investments, and regulatory support for medical material advancements. Europe follows closely, driven by stringent medical regulations and increasing demand for biocompatible materials in medical devices and implants. The Asia-Pacific region is emerging as a key growth hub, particularly in countries like China and India, where rising healthcare expenditures, growing medical tourism, and expanding medical manufacturing industries contribute to market expansion.
